Home
last modified time | relevance | path

Searched refs:DwarfUnit (Results 1 – 11 of 11) sorted by relevance

/netbsd-src/external/apache2/llvm/dist/llvm/lib/CodeGen/AsmPrinter/
H A DDwarfUnit.cpp90 DwarfUnit::DwarfUnit(dwarf::Tag UnitTag, const DICompileUnit *Node, in DwarfUnit() function in DwarfUnit
98 : DwarfUnit(dwarf::DW_TAG_type_unit, CU.getCUNode(), A, DW, DWU), CU(CU), in DwarfTypeUnit()
102 DwarfUnit::~DwarfUnit() { in ~DwarfUnit()
109 int64_t DwarfUnit::getDefaultLowerBound() const { in getDefaultLowerBound()
188 bool DwarfUnit::isShareableAcrossCUs(const DINode *D) const { in isShareableAcrossCUs()
202 DIE *DwarfUnit::getDIE(const DINode *D) const { in getDIE()
208 void DwarfUnit::insertDIE(const DINode *Desc, DIE *D) { in insertDIE()
216 void DwarfUnit::insertDIE(DIE *D) { in insertDIE()
220 void DwarfUnit::addFlag(DIE &Die, dwarf::Attribute Attribute) { in addFlag()
227 void DwarfUnit::addUInt(DIEValueList &Die, dwarf::Attribute Attribute, in addUInt()
[all …]
H A DDwarfFile.h30 class DwarfUnit; variable
121 unsigned computeSizeAndOffsetsForUnit(DwarfUnit *TheU);
131 void emitUnit(DwarfUnit *TheU, bool UseOffsets);
H A DDwarfUnit.h37 class DwarfUnit : public DIEUnit {
73 DwarfUnit(dwarf::Tag, const DICompileUnit *Node, AsmPrinter *A, DwarfDebug *DW,
301 ~DwarfUnit();
351 class DwarfTypeUnit final : public DwarfUnit {
372 return DwarfUnit::getHeaderSize() + sizeof(uint64_t) + // Type Signature in getHeaderSize()
H A DDwarfFile.cpp36 void DwarfFile::emitUnit(DwarfUnit *TheU, bool UseOffsets) { in emitUnit()
82 unsigned DwarfFile::computeSizeAndOffsetsForUnit(DwarfUnit *TheU) { in computeSizeAndOffsetsForUnit()
H A DCMakeLists.txt20 DwarfUnit.cpp
H A DDwarfCompileUnit.h47 class DwarfCompileUnit final : public DwarfUnit {
289 return DwarfUnit::getHeaderSize() + DWOIdSize; in getHeaderSize()
H A DDwarfDebug.h56 class DwarfUnit; variable
563 void initSkeletonUnit(const DwarfUnit &U, DIE &Die,
H A DDwarfCompileUnit.cpp61 : DwarfUnit(GetCompileUnitType(Kind, DW), Node, A, DW, DWU), UniqueID(UID) { in DwarfCompileUnit()
1342 DwarfUnit::emitCommonHeader(UseOffsets, UT); in emitHeader()
H A DDwarfDebug.cpp2298 static dwarf::PubIndexEntryDescriptor computeIndexValue(DwarfUnit *CU, in computeIndexValue()
3196 void DwarfDebug::initSkeletonUnit(const DwarfUnit &U, DIE &Die, in initSkeletonUnit()
/netbsd-src/external/apache2/llvm/lib/libLLVMAsmPrinter/
H A DMakefile28 DwarfUnit.cpp \
/netbsd-src/external/apache2/llvm/dist/llvm/utils/gn/secondary/llvm/lib/CodeGen/AsmPrinter/
H A DBUILD.gn37 "DwarfUnit.cpp",